Blackhold

Particiones gpt

Posted on maig 18th, 2014 by admin

Cuando nos encontramos con discos duros grandes, es posible que queramos hacer particiones de más de 2,2Tb, el sistema de particionado MBR (el que se viene usando toda la vida, con 4 particiones primarias) se nos queda pequeño y no es posible gestionar particiones de más de 2,2Tb, para ello tenemos que usar otro tipo de particiones, las GPT o GUID, que soporta particiones de hasta 9,4Zb (1 zettabyte = 1 bilión de terabytes) además de algunas mejoras como la definición de la tabla de particiones al principio y al final del disco.
El numero de particiones primarias que nos permite GPT es de 128.

Si quieres más información sobre este tipo de particiones:

Tabla de particiones GUID

Ahora nos encontramos con una maquina a la que le hemos añadido 2 discos de 3Tb y queremos hacer 2 particiones de 3Tb, una para cada disco, para crear y gestionar estas particiones necesitamos instalar gdisk.

root@adhara:~# apt-get install gdisk

En kernels nuevos, el soporte EFI para estas particiones ya viene activado por defecto, pero para verificarlo hacemos:

root@adhara:~# cat /boot/config-`uname -r` | grep CONFIG_EFI= 
CONFIG_EFI=y

El funcionamiento de gdisk es muy similar a fdisk, así que vamos a particionar los discos con esta aplicación.

root@adhara:~# gdisk /dev/sdb
GPT fdisk (gdisk) version 0.8.8

Partition table scan:
  MBR: protective
  BSD: not present
  APM: not present
  GPT: present

Found valid GPT with protective MBR; using GPT.

Command (? for help): n
Partition number (1-128, default 1): 
First sector (34-5860533134, default = 40) or {+-}size{KMGTP}: 
Last sector (40-5860533134, default = 5860533134) or {+-}size{KMGTP}: 
Current type is 'Linux filesystem'
Hex code or GUID (L to show codes, Enter = 8300): 
Changed type of partition to 'Linux filesystem'

Command (? for help): p
Disk /dev/sdb: 5860533168 sectors, 2.7 TiB
Logical sector size: 512 bytes
Disk identifier (GUID): 08C6B72A-1978-4E29-B8CC-12F979D4FC67
Partition table holds up to 128 entries
First usable sector is 34, last usable sector is 5860533134
Partitions will be aligned on 8-sector boundaries
Total free space is 6 sectors (3.0 KiB)

Number  Start (sector)    End (sector)  Size       Code  Name
   1              40      5860533134   2.7 TiB     8300  Linux filesystem

Command (? for help): w

Final checks complete. About to write GPT data. THIS WILL OVERWRITE EXISTING
PARTITIONS!!

Do you want to proceed? (Y/N): y
OK; writing new GUID partition table (GPT) to /dev/sdb.
The operation has completed successfully.

Hago lo mismo con el otro disco

Ahora lo siguiente es formatear las particiones con mkfs y esperar un buen rato :P

root@adhara:~# mkfs -t ext4 /dev/sdb1
root@adhara:~# mkfs -t ext4 /dev/sdc1

Ahora montar los discos en el sitio que deseemos

root@adhara:~# mkdir /mnt/hd1
root@adhara:~# mkdir /mnt/hd2
root@adhara:~# ls -l /dev/disk/by-uuid/
total 0
lrwxrwxrwx 1 root root 10 May 18 16:36 08f6dcc4-551c-4045-aa1b-e0f8fd93ac29 -> ../../sdc1
lrwxrwxrwx 1 root root 10 May 18 15:51 0feee2d3-d63d-4cd4-baac-de85e1b3e0a7 -> ../../sda5
lrwxrwxrwx 1 root root 10 May 18 15:51 d94c5239-0ad8-4200-955a-77775f723de2 -> ../../sda1
root@adhara:~# vi /etc/fstab
UUID=08f6dcc4-551c-4045-aa1b-e0f8fd93ac29 /mnt/hd2      ext4    defaults        0       0

Si os fijáis el sdb me está dando problemas, que no aparece en el listado, pero es hacer lo mismo. El lunes va a tocar a ir a la tienda a reemplazarlo! :(

Más información: Particiones GPT

This entry was posted on diumenge, maig 18th, 2014 at 17:00 and is filed under filesystems. You can follow any responses to this entry through the RSS 2.0 feed. You can leave a response, or trackback from your own site.

« »

guy fawkes